Intel's annual median pay has been stagnant compared to peers like Nvidia and Microsoft

Intel aims to reduce costs by $10 billion, enhance chip factories with CHIPS Act funding, and implemented measures like pay cuts for executives and bonuses for employees. Despite setbacks like layoffs, the company received $7.9 billion in grant funding for expansion. Interest in a Qualcomm buyout has decreased.
